Caloris WRF has been nominated as a finalist in the prestigious Cooling Industry Awards 2009.
This award winning system (recently successful in the H&V News awards) has demonstrated its flexibility and efficiency as a safe and credible alternative to VRF air conditioning systems.
Flexible due to quick installation (two pipe uninsulated system). Flexibility in utilising external air source or ground source heat pumps or the award wining hybrid system consisting a combination of both air and ground source.
Flexible in being able to heat and cool at the same time.
Efficiency due to localised indoor heat pumps linked to external heat pumps with a wide temperature bandwidth resulting in low running operation (External units only need to run approximately 10% annually).
Efficiency due to high COP levels of up to 6.
Safe - WRF utilises water rather than refrigerant as its main energy transfer medium.
